About This Item
Oxford, England: Phaidon-Christie's Limited, 1984. First Edition, First Printing.
Quarto (11 1/4 x 8 1/2 inches; 285 x 215 mm), 319, [1] pages, green cloth, in an unclipped, photo-illustrated dust jacket (hard cover).
Lavishly illustrated guide to Chinese ceramics. An important reference work by the former director of the ceramics department at Christie's.
CONDITION: Light scratch to upper board, light soiling to top and bottom edges but internally clean, bright, and unmarked. Slight edge wear and a bit of scuffing to the unclipped dust jacket, along with a small closed tear to top edge of rear panel. Overall, Near Fine.
